Are there residential (inpatient) rehab centers located directly in Little Suamico, WI?

Little Suamico is a small village, so there are no residential rehab facilities within its immediate village limits. However, residents typically access inpatient treatment at centers located in nearby larger cities like Green Bay, Oconto, or Appleton, which are within a 30-45 minute drive and offer a range of programs.

What local resources in Little Suamico, WI, can provide immediate support or referrals for addiction treatment?

For immediate local support, the Little Suamico area is served by the Oconto County Department of Human Services, which can provide assessments, referrals, and information on county-based treatment options. Additionally, connecting with primary care physicians at clinics like Prevea Health in the surrounding area or calling the 988 Suicide & Crisis Lifeline can offer crucial first-step guidance.

How do I find and choose an outpatient treatment program near Little Suamico, WI?

To find outpatient programs, start by consulting the Oconto County Human Services directory or using online tools like SAMHSA's Treatment Locator filtered for the Green Bay area. Many reputable providers, such as Bellin Health or Libertas Treatment Center, have outpatient satellite services in Brown and Oconto Counties, making them accessible for Little Suamico residents seeking flexible, local care.

Does Wisconsin's BadgerCare Plus (Medicaid) cover addiction treatment for Little Suamico residents, and which local providers accept it?

Yes, BadgerCare Plus covers substance use disorder treatment. Residents should verify their eligibility and specific coverage details. Many treatment providers in the Green Bay and Oconto County region, including community behavioral health clinics, accept BadgerCare. It's advisable to contact providers like Family Services of Northeast Wisconsin or Northlakes Community Clinic directly to confirm acceptance and available services.

What should a family in Little Suamico, WI, expect when helping a loved one enter detox or rehab?

Families should expect to help coordinate initial assessments, often starting with a call to a county crisis line or a nearby hospital like HSHS St. Vincent Hospital in Green Bay for medical detox needs. The process typically involves verifying insurance, arranging transportation to a facility outside the village, and engaging with family support programs offered by the chosen treatment center to be part of the recovery journey.

For residents of Little Suamico, seeking treatment often means looking toward the broader Green Bay area, which serves as a hub for comprehensive care. Several reputable treatment centers and support networks are within a reasonable driving distance, offering various levels of care tailored to individual needs. These can range from medically supervised detoxification and residential inpatient programs to intensive outpatient services and ongoing counseling. It's important to find a program that aligns with your specific situation, whether you're struggling with alcohol, opioids, or other substances. Many facilities now offer personalized treatment plans that address not only the addiction itself but also underlying mental health concerns, which is a critical component of sustainable recovery. This integrated approach helps build a stronger foundation for your new life. Beyond formal treatment centers, the bedrock of lasting recovery in our area is often found in community support. Little Suamico and the surrounding towns have a strong network of mutual aid groups. Regular meetings of Alcoholics Anonymous, Narcotics Anonymous, and other recovery fellowships are held in nearby communities like Green Bay, Oconto, and Suamico. These groups provide a safe, confidential space to share experiences, find mentorship, and build a sober support system with people who truly understand the journey. Additionally, consider speaking with your primary care physician in the Oconto County area. They can be a valuable ally, offering referrals to local specialists, discussing medication-assisted treatment options if appropriate, and providing non-judgmental support. Don't underestimate the power of building a local team for your recovery. Starting the search for help is the most significant step. If you're in Little Suamico today, consider calling a national helpline like SAMHSA's National Helpline at 1-800-662-HELP (4357). It's free, confidential, and available 24/7 to provide treatment referrals and information for services in Wisconsin.
